
What is VVVF Drive - ALLInterview
VVVF Drive meaning is Variable Voltage Variable frequency drive. It is used to three phase induction motor and some type of single phase motor can be used. It is used to variable speed in Same voltage. It is change the motor frequency in constant voltage.

advantages of vvvf drives over non vvvf drives for EOT - ALLInterview
Answer / vinod. smooth start and stop. no jerking of load. exact posiitoning better protection for motor. high/low speed selection.
